11. How much energy is required to heat 120.0g of water from 2.0 C to 24 C

Answers

Answer:The specific heat of water is 1 calorie/gram °C = 4.186 joule/gram °C.

Explanation:Therefore the required amount of energy is following:

Q = c*m*dT = 4.186 * 120 * (24 - 2) = 11,051 J

liquid hexane will react with gaseous oxygen to produce gaseous carbon dioxide and gaseous water . suppose 43. g of hexane is mixed with 85.1 g of oxygen. calculate the maximum mass of water that could be produced by the chemical reaction. round your answer to significant digits.

Answers

The mass of water produced is 35.27g in the given chemical reaction.

A chemical reaction is the chemical change of one set of chemical components into another. A chemical reaction is the process through which two or more molecules combine to create a new product(s). Compounds that combine to make new compounds are referred to as reactants, while the newly produced compounds are referred to as products. When chemical bonds between atoms are established or destroyed, chemical reactions occur. Breaking chemical bonds between reactant molecules and establishing new bonds between atoms in product particles are examples of chemical reactions. The number of atoms is the same before and after the chemical transition, but the number of molecules changes.

Balanced equation:

[tex]2C_6H_{14} + 19O_2 \rightarrow 12CO_2 + 14H_2)[/tex]

Given:

Mass of hexane = 43g

Mass of oxygen = 85.1g

To find:

Mass of water formed = ?

Calculations:

According to the balanced equation, 2 moles of hexane react with 19 moles of oxygen to form 12 moles of carbon dioxide and 14 moles of water.

Molar mass of hexane = 86.118g/mol

Molar mass of oxygen = 32g/mol

(2 x 86.118)g of hexane required = (19 x 32)g of oxygen

43g of hexane required = (19 x 32) / (2 x 86.118) x 43

= 151.79g of oxygen

But we have only 85.1g of oxygen, thus it is a limiting reagent

Now,

(19 x 32)g of oxygen reacts to produce = (14 x 18)g of water

85.1g of oxygen reacts to produce = (14 x 18) / (19 x 32) x 85.1

= 35.271g of water

Result:

35.27g of water is produced.

In the fahrenheit temperature scale, water freezes at 32°f and boils at 212°f. In the celsius scale, water freezes at 0°c and boils at 100°c. Given that the fahrenheit temperature f and the celsius temperature c are related by a linear equation, find f in terms of c.

Answers

The temperature reading on Fahrenheit scale is related to the The temperature reading on Celsius scale by a linear equation F = 9/5 C + 32

Data for Fahrenheit temperature scale:

Water freezing point = 32⁰

Water boiling point = 212⁰

Therefore, the scale is divided into 212 - 32 = 180 scales.

Data for Celsius temperature scale:

Water freezing point = 0⁰

Water boiling point = 100⁰

Therefore, the scale is divided into 100 - 0 = 100 scales.

Scale ratio:

C : F = 100 : 180 = 5 : 9

It means each increment of 1⁰ on Celsius scale is equal to an increment of 9/5 degree on Fahrenheit scale. However, we need to add an offset 32⁰ on Fahrenheit scale.

Hence,  the reading C⁰ on Celsius scale is equivalent to:

F = 9/5 C + 32

Aluminium appears unreactive. This is because it has a layer of what covering its surface?
Enter your answer

Answers

Aluminium appears unreactive. This is because of the formation of aluminium oxide layer in its outer surface.

This is because aluminium reacts with oxygen present in air to form a thin layer of aluminium oxide on its surface. This oxide layer is very stable and acts as a protective coating by preventing further reaction of aluminium.

in setting up this experiment, a student noticed that a bubble of air leaked into the eudiometer tube when it was inverted in the water bath. what effect would this have on the measured volume of hydrogen gas? would the calculated molar volume of hydrogen be too high or too low as a result of this error? explain.

Answers

The calculated molar volume of hydrogen will be too high as a result of this error

The gas being recorded during the experiment would not only include hydrogen gas, but the air that leaked into the eudiometer tube as well. This leads to the increase in the volume of hydrogen gas which will be too high. Since the volume of hydrogen is too high,  the calculated molar volume of hydrogen would also be too high.

the molar absorptivity of a compound at 500 nm wavelength is 252 m-1cm-1. suppose one prepares a solution by dissolving 0.00140 moles of a solute in enough water to make a 500.0 ml solution. what would be the absorbance in a 6 .00 mm pathlength cell? type answer:

Answers

Based on Beer's law and the data provided (molar absorptivity, number of moles, volume of the solution, cell dimension) we can calculate that the absorbance of the sample will be 0.42336.

According to Beer's law, the measured absorbance is proportional to the molar absorptivity of the substance, its molarity in the sample, and the pathlength of the cell:

A = ε * c * l

ε - molar absorptivity (252 M⁻¹cm⁻¹)

c - molarity of the sample

l - pathlength (6.00 mm = 0.6 cm)

To calculate the absorptivity we need to calculate the molarity of the sample:

c = n/V = 0.00140 mol / 0.5000 L = 0.00280 M

A = 252 M⁻¹cm⁻¹ * 0.00280 M * 0.6 cm = 0.42336
